Young Legend’s League gets under way in Mizoram!

A football league for children under 12 years of age called the Young Legend’s League was kicked off yesterday, November 11 at Chhangphut Field, Champhai in Mizoram. The YLL is a ‘baby league’ organised jointly by 8One Foundation, New Delhi and the Mizoram Football Association. The league will provide competitive …

NorthEast United FC returns to Guwahati ahead of the start of ISL-4!

Indian Super league franchise NorthEast United FC have returned to their base in Guwahati on Saturday, November 11 after spending two weeks in Antalya, Turkey for their pre-season camp. Coached by Portuguese Joao De Deus, the Highlanders played a total of six friendly matches in Turkey. NorthEast United FC captain …

First report of FIFA’s Human Rights Advisory Board published!

The Human Rights Advisory Board, which was created in early 2017 to provide independent advice on FIFA’s human rights responsibilities, published its first report today. In their report, the expert group of eight representatives from the UN System, civil society, trade unions and FIFA sponsors discusses FIFA’s work on human …
